WebApr 15, 2024 · The Natchez cultivar (and other types, as well) prefers full sun and well-drained soil. Exposure to full sun can help prevent some of the less mildew-resistant varieties of crepe myrtle trees from succumbing to the disease. Soil pH should range from 5.0 to 6.5. WebOct 29, 2024 · The crepe myrtle tree is a fast grower. Each year, it can sprout 12 into 18 new growth, where flowers bloom. The crepe myrtle tree's flower will only grow on new growth. If a season's frigid weather stunts the growth of branches, flowers may not bloom. The tree's counterpart, its shrub, takes more time to mature.
